Rand Capital Corp (RAND) — Defensive Interval Ratio
Rand Capital Corp (RAND) has a Defensive Interval Ratio of 94 days as of September 2025. Defensive assets of $183.74K (cash $-, short-term investments $-, receivables $183.74K) cover 94 days of daily cash needs of $1.94K/day. Annual Defensive Interval Ratio for Rand Capital Corp (2001–2024)
The table below presents the year-by-year Defensive Interval Ratio for Rand Capital Corp from 2001 to 2024, covering 23 annual filings. Each row shows defensive assets, daily cash need, the DIR in days, and the change in days compared to the prior year. | Year | DIR (days) | Defensive Assets (USD) | Daily Cash Need | Cash | ST Investments | Change (days)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| 64 days | $393.58K | $6.19K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-43 days |
| 2023 | 107 days | $329.69K | $3.08K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-21330 days |
| 2022 | 21437 days | $3.92 Million | $182.68/day | $- | $3.54 Million | ▼ -194499 days |
| 2021 | 215935 days | $30.58 Million | $141.61/day | $- | $30.28 Million | ▲ +215903 days |
| 2020 | 33 days | $323.89K | $9.88K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-398 days |
| 2019 | 431 days | $399.35K | $927.22/day | $- | $- | ▲ +276 days |
| 2018 | 155 days | $156.96K | $1.02K/day | $- | $- | ▲ +31 days |
| 2017 | 124 days | $271.41K | $2.19K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-1328 days |
| 2016 | 1452 days | $1.46 Million | $1.00K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-75201 days |
| 2015 | 76653 days | $1.81 Million | $23.59/day | $- | $- | ▲ +68551 days |
| 2014 | 8102 days | $165.09K | $20.38/day | $- | $- | ▲ +8039 days |
| 2013 | 62 days | $1.40 Million | $22.53K/day | $- | $- | ▲ +59 days |
| 2012 | 3 days | $51.86K | $14.96K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-2779 days |
| 2011 | 2782 days | $1.90 Million | $682.73/day | $- | $- | ▲ +2747 days |
| 2010 | 35 days | $1.05 Million | $30.11K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-974 days |
| 2009 | 1009 days | $1.19 Million | $1.18K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-255 days |
| 2008 | 1264 days | $1.01 Million | $802.00/day | $- | $- | ▲ +817 days |
| 2007 | 447 days | $647.00K | $1.45K/day | $- | $- | ▲ +41 days |
| 2006 | 406 days | $507.24K | $1.25K/day | $- | $- | ▼ -29 days |
| 2005 | 435 days | $297.62K | $684.93/day | $- | $- | ▲ +2 days |
| 2004 | 432 days | $260.49K | $602.74/day | $- | $- | ▼ -395 days |
| 2003 | 827 days | $340.00K | $410.96/day | $- | $- | ▼ -684 days |
| 2001 | 1512 days | $167.84K | $111.04/day | $- | $- | — |
